Blank coffee bags are a popular choice among coffee roasters and retailers. They provide a versatile solution that can cater to various storage needs while also maintaining the quality of the coffee.
Preservation of Freshness: Blank coffee bags are typically made from materials that protect the beans from light, air, and moisture—three elements that can degrade the quality of coffee. By selecting a high-quality bag, you ensure that your beans stay fresh longer.
Customizable Options: One of the standout features of these bags is their ability to be customized. You can print your brand’s logo, product information, and even brewing tips right on the bag. This not only helps in branding but also gives consumers important information at a glance.
Sustainability: Many blank coffee bags can be made from recyclable or biodegradable materials. As consumers become more environmentally conscious, opting for sustainable packaging can set your product apart in the marketplace.
Selecting the right blank coffee bag involves understanding what features are essential for preserving your whole beans. Here are some aspects to consider:
Barrier Properties: Look for bags that have multi-layer construction, which offers enhanced protection against external factors. A good barrier will keep oxygen out and the aroma and freshness of the coffee in.
Valve or No Valve: Some coffee bags come with one-way valves that allow gases from freshly roasted beans to escape without letting air in. This is particularly beneficial if you are packaging freshly roasted coffee, as it can prevent bags from bursting while maintaining a sealed environment.
Size Options: Consider the quantity of beans you typically sell. Blank coffee bags come in various sizes, so choosing the right size can prevent waste and ensure optimum freshness for your consumers.

Seal Properly: Make sure to use heat sealing or zip-lock features of the bags to create an airtight seal after filling. This simple action can dramatically extend the lifespan of your coffee.
Store in a Cool, Dark Place: Even though the bags protect beans from light and air, storing them in a suitable environment is essential. A cool and dark cupboard is best for maintaining optimal freshness.
Rotate Stock: If you’re a retailer, practice the FIFO (First In, First Out) method. Always sell or use older stock first before newer batches, ensuring that you always provide the freshest product to your customers.
What are the advantages of using one-way valve coffee bags?
One-way valve bags enable gases released from roasted beans to escape without allowing outside air in. This is crucial for maintaining freshness and preventing damage to the beans.
Can I reuse blank coffee bags?
While it’s technically possible to reuse bags, it’s not recommended. Previous contents can leave residues or stale odors, affecting the freshness of new beans stored inside. For the best quality, always use a clean, new bag.
Are blank coffee bags expensive?
The cost of blank coffee bags can vary widely based on material, customization options, and ordering quantities. However, investing in quality packaging is crucial when you want to maintain the integrity of your whole beans.
